The earliest material and representational proof of Egyptian musical instruments dates towards the Predynastic period of time, though the proof is more securely attested in the Outdated Kingdom when harps, flutes and double clarinets have been performed.[32] Percussion instruments, lyres, and lutes were being extra to orchestras by the Middle Kingdom.

A performance can either be planned out and rehearsed (practiced)—that's the norm in classical music, jazz significant bands, and lots of well known music models–or improvised over a chord progression (a sequence of chords), which happens to be the norm in little jazz and blues groups. Rehearsals of orchestras, live performance bands and choirs are led by a conductor.

In classical music, the composer typically orchestrates his / her very own compositions, but in musical theatre As well as in pop music, songwriters may well seek the services of an arranger to accomplish the orchestration. In some cases, a songwriter might not use notation in the least, and alternatively, compose the music in her brain and then Enjoy or document it from memory. In jazz and popular music, noteworthy recordings by influential performers are supplied the burden that composed scores Participate in in classical music.[72][seventy three]
